Composite anti-falling beam embedded plate for bridge
The invention provides a composite anti-beam-falling embedded plate for a bridge, and relates to the technical field of bridge construction. The composite anti-falling beam pre-embedded plate for the bridge comprises a fixing plate, pre-embedded steel bars and pre-embedded cylinders, mounting through holes which are uniformly distributed and vertically run through are formed in the fixing plate, the pre-embedded cylinders are slidably connected to the inner sides of the mounting through holes, and a plurality of annularly and uniformly distributed pre-embedded steel bars are slidably connected to the outer sides of the bottom ends of the pre-embedded cylinders. And the bottom ends of the embedded steel bars evenly distributed in the same ring are fixedly connected to the upper side of the same connecting bottom plate, external pressing triangular blocks are fixedly connected to the outer sides of the embedded steel bars, and mounting threaded holes are formed in the embedded barrels. The fixing plate and the embedded steel bars are fixedly installed at the preset embedding points through the embedded barrel, when the embedded barrel and the embedded steel bars can be controlled to expand outwards, the external pressing triangular blocks are jacked into the outer walls of the embedded steel bars to fixedly install the fixing plate, and the stability of the fixing plate during installation is improved.
